Price of the Tools
A heat pump is an extra sustainable method to heat up a home than other alternatives, including electric-resistance heaters and oil or propane heaters. Its operating costs are less than that of fossil fuels because it uses electrical energy to power itself, and if you utilize a renewable energy source like roof solar or area solar to power your home's electrical system, the heat pump is even more lasting.



Heatpump are offered in air-to-air, water resource and geothermal versions, and each kind has its very own setup expenses. For example, a geothermal heat pump attracts warm from the ground-- and that can require land excavation and/or trenches for installing the piping that lugs the heat-exchange fluid.

The majority of heatpump rely upon air ducts to disperse conditioned air throughout the home. That contributes to labor prices, specifically if your ducts need to be changed or aren't healthy. A mini-split heatpump that does not count on ducts is cheaper to set up, yet that model isn't suitable for every single home.

A heatpump can be mounted to replace your existing central air system, or as part of a new home building. When replacing an existing system, an accredited a/c specialist can commonly use the home's current ductwork. New ductwork is extra costly, however.

Before mounting https://mgyb-thug.s3.amazonaws.com/dc-installation-services.html , a contractor ought to do a load estimation using an identified method such as ACCA's Guidebook J. This determines the correct size heat pump for your home, ensuring it's not too huge or too tiny. It factors in your environment, your home's materials and insulation degree, variety of doors and windows, layout size and layout, the direction your home windows face and just how impermeable your house is.

Expense of Services
Just like any kind of kind of heating and cooling equipment, heat pumps require routine maintenance. This is commonly done by a professional that has the needed certifications and licensing to take care of refrigerants and electric terminals.

Throughout a maintenance visit, the professional will certainly clean up and inspect all areas connected with your heat pump consisting of the duct, filters, blower, coils, drain line and pan, follower, and electric motors. In addition, they will certainly check for any indications of an issue such as leakages, reduced air flow, temperature issues, the appropriate cooling agent fee and any type of rattles, squeaks or grinding sounds that may indicate mechanical damage.

It is typically suggested that home owners arrange 2 routine maintenance check outs yearly for their heat pump to ensure it works effectively throughout the cooling and heating seasons. This will help them prevent costly repair services in the future.

Expense of Replacement
Like all types of cooling and heating equipment, heatpump require maintenance to maintain them operating properly. An accredited solution professional ought to deal with most repair. Components that need changing aren't offered to the public, and they usually need to be custom-ordered. This can include in the general expense of a heat pump repair service.

Your heat pump's refrigerant lines may require to be replaced as a result of harm, wear and tear or a leakage. Expect to pay $150 to $700 for a brand-new line set. The reversing shutoff is another important part that manages the flow of refrigerant relying on whether your heat pump is heating or cooling down.
